Allgemein

Hersteller: Heco

Modell: Victa 701

Baujahre: 2010 - 2015

Hergestellt in: 50259 Pulheim, Deutschland

Farbe: Black

Abmessungen: 1050 x 230 x 305 mm (HxBxT)

Gewicht: 17 kg

Neupreis ca.: 200,- €/Stück (im Angebot beim großen "C")

Technische Daten

Bauart: 3-Wege Bassreflex, Standlautsprecher

Chassis:

Tieftöner: 2x 170 mm

Mitteltöner: 1x 170 mm

Hochtöner: 1x 25 mm (Kunstseiden-Kalotte)

Belastbarkeit (Nenn-/Musikb.): 160 / 300 Watt

Wirkungsgrad: 91 dB

Frequenzgang: 26 - 38.000 Hz

Übergangsbereiche: 400 / 3.200 Hz

Impedanz: 4 - 8 Ohm

Besondere Ausstattungen

Bi-Wiring/-Amping-Terminal

Spices / Gummi- Spices

About HECO

HECO traces its roots to 1949, when Gerhard Richard Hennel and his wife Susanne founded Hennel & Co. KG in the German Taunus region town of Schmitten. Initially focused on manufacturing speaker chassis and baskets for cinemas and restaurants, the family business quickly pivoted to high-quality home audio, producing its first series-production speaker chassis in 1950 and the legendary compact B130 model by 1964. This heritage of German engineering precision has defined HECO for over seven decades, evolving through innovations like the 1951 Orchester Type C16 and early multichannel speaker sets.

The brand specializes in premium loudspeakers, with iconic series such as Superior (1987), Concerto Grosso, and Celan (launched 2005 and continually refined) anchoring its reputation. HECO has occasionally ventured into car audio with lines like Sprint and Turbo amplifiers in the 1990s, but its core strength remains floorstanding, bookshelf, and compact home speakers renowned for balanced, dynamic sound. Ambitious designs prioritize music reproduction in domestic settings, blending tradition with modern materials.

Positioned as a mid-to-high-end contender, HECO commands respect among discerning hi-fi enthusiasts for exceptional price-to-performance ratios, numerous test victories, and enduring series that rival pricier rivals. No longer a small family operation but part of Audio-Produkte GmbH, it sustains innovative momentum, delivering "true sound" that appeals to knowledgeable buyers seeking reliable German quality without ultra-boutique excess.
